#6834b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6834bf is composed of 40.8% red, 20.4%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.5% cyan, 72.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 262.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 47.6%. #6834bf color hex could be obtained by blending #d068ff with #00007f.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#6834b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030206 is the darkest color, while #f8f6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6834bf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78757e is the less saturated color, while #5c05ee is the most saturated one.
